Encrypted filesystem library for TypeScript/JavaScript applications

* Virtualised - files, directories, permissions are all virtual constructs, they do not correspond to real filesystems
* Orthogonally Persistent - all writes automatically persisted
* Encrypted-At-Rest - all persistence is encrypted
* Random Read & Write - encryption and decryption operates over fixed-block sizes
* Streamable - files do not need to loaded fully in-memory
* Comprehensive continuous benchmarks in CI/CD

There are some differences between EFS and Node FS:

* User, Group and Other permissions: In EFS User, Group and Other permissions are strictly confined to their permission class. For example, a User in EFS does not have the permissions that a Group or Other has while in Node FS a User also has permissions that Group and Other have.
* Sticky Files: In Node FS, a sticky bit is a permission bit that is set on a file or a directory that lets only the owner of the file/directory or the root user to delete or rename the file. EFS does not support the use of sticky bits.
* Character Devices: Node FS contains Character Devices which can be written to and read from. However, in EFS Character Devices are not supported yet.
